I was only 28 when I joined an unexpectedly popular club. Together, with more than 53 million Americans (and 1.5 million Illinoisans), I became a family caregiver when my father was diagnosed with early onset dementia. A few years later, our situation escalated when my mother’s cancer reemerged, and her cardiac and lung conditions worsened.
This situation is unfortunately now a common, yet silent, milestone across households in every community. Even more so for immigrant families like mine and for women who assume family care responsibilities quickly and often without support.
